  • Wichita Rugby Playing for Div III National Championship

    Wichita Rugby Barbarians beat Colusa California and Dallas Athletic Club Rugby 14-10 in the semis to earn the right to play for the D-III Club National Championship on June 13th in Denver.

    They've been good for a few years now, but this is their first trip to the National Championship.

    Congrats to a club that started pretty much from scratch in the early-90's.

              I counted more than 150 DIII teams across the country. 32 teams made the Championship draw. They beat in conference KC Blues (avenging their only loss of the season) 34-7.

              In the round of 16 they beat the Queen City Rams 66-0 (a team that beat the previously 12-0 St Louis Royals 22-10 in the round of 32).

              Then as mentioned earlier they beat NoCal Colusa County (11-1) 35-14 in the round of 8 and Dallas Athletic (13-0) 14-10 in the semis.

              Now the 12-0 Tri Cities Barbarians from Michigan await in the Barbarians from Wichita in the finals. Tri Cities was in the semis last year and is 28-1 over the last 2 years.

                    Champions!

                    WBRFC defeats TCBRFC 30-28 to win the DIII Club Championship. Very dramatic ending with a try to win called back and Wichita making a penalty kick at the whistle to take the match and championship.
